JACK Rack is an open source Linux application for audio effects and virtual instrument processing. It allows you to easily route audio and MIDI between JACK-enabled applications. JACK Rack features a flexible graphical user interface for applying effects like reverb, equalization, dynamics and more.
Koe Recast is a voice cloning and synthesis software that allows users to create custom voice avatars from audio samples. It utilizes deep learning for highly accurate voice cloning.
